ใช้คำสั่ง redirect ใน hook แล้วมัน refresh ตลอดเวลาครับ


ใช้คำสั่ง redirect ใน hook แล้วมัน refresh ตลอดเวลาครับ


<?php
class Onload {

private $CI;

public function __construct(){

$this->CI =& get_instance();

}

public function check_login(){

if($this->CI){

redirect('users/user/register_form','refresh');
exit();

}


}

}
?>


ผมจะทำ check login แต่พอมัน redirect ไปแล้ว ฟังก์ชั่น exit() ไม่ยอมทำงาน มันรีเฟรชตลอดเวลาเลยครับ

โพสเมื่อ : 2014-01-23 11:16:12 | 5 ปี , 3 เดือน , 3 สัปดาห์ , 3 วัน , 11 ชั่วโมง ผ่านมา
มันทำที่ Onload ไม่ได้ครับ เพราะ users/user/register_form ต้องวิ่งผ่านเหมือนกัน แล้วจะเช็คตัวใหน ว่า login แล้วหรือยัง
วิธีเช็ค Login แล้วปรกติผมจะเขียนเป็น model ครับ เพราะบาง controller เช่น users สำหรับเข้ามา login ก็ไม่ต้องตรวจสอบ

ลำดับ : 1 | ตอบเมื่อ : 2014-01-23 15:50:56 | 5 ปี , 3 เดือน , 3 สัปดาห์ , 3 วัน , 7 ชั่วโมง ผ่านมา
เข้าสู่ระบบ
คงสถานะการเข้าระบบ